www.cs.helsinki.fiincreases. (3) After some time, when dynamical equilibrium between the escaping and returning molecules is established, the water vapor pressure becomes saturated. Saturated water vapor pressure is a function of temperature only and independent on the presence of other gases. The temperature dependence is exponential. For water vapor

bioinformaticsalgorithms.comA Introduction to Pseudocode What is Pseudocode? An algorithm is a sequence of instructions to solve a well-formulated computational problem specified in terms of its input and output.An algorithm uses the input to generate the output. For example, the algorithm PATTERN COUNTuses strings Text and Pattern as input to generate the number COUNT(Text,Pattern) …
